One of the most common problems that can be encountered with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ism becomes stiff or jammed. You can grease your lock and handle with graphite or machine oil. This will allow the lock mechanism to be unlocked and the window or door to function normally once again.

The hinges can be st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by dust and grit building on the hinges. The solution is to grease the hinges with grease or oil. The wrong type of lubricant could harm the hinges and make them inoperable.

Stained Glass Repairs

Stained glass windows are stunning features in homes, churches and other structures. They add visual interest, privacy and light to an area. However, they are fragile and must be carefully maintained to ensure they are in good condition. Even with the best care, stained and lead glass windows can deteriorate as they age due to aging and exposure to weather and other environmental elements. This can lead to cracks, fading, or water leakage. If you have st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it is essential to find an expert in your area who can restore the window to its original splendor.

The cost of repairing broken or cracked stained glass is $500. The exact cost will depend on the kind of solution needed to solve the issue. For instance professional technicians may use cop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to fix the broken glass. They may also re-lead the lead cames and seal the stained glass. There are a variety of alternatives each with distinct advantages and costs. The best solution depends on the size, location and type of glass used.

Cracks in the leaded glass may be caused by thermal expansion, vibrations or contraction and building movements, or just norm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and create larger problems as time passes. To prevent further damage and enlargement, a crack that runs across the face of a stained-glass panel or the face must be fixed as fast as is possible. In the past, this was done by splicing a "Dutchman's" lead flange onto the crack. This was not a good method of repair, and there are now better methods of fixing cracks like these.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through gaps around windows and doors. It is an important aspect of home maintenance that could help you save money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It can also make a home more comfortable. The materials used in the construction of this seal can deteriorate with time, due to wear and tear. It is important to replace these materials periodically.

You can determine whether your weather stripping has been damaged by noticing a wet spot after washing the windows, a whistling noise when driving down the road, or a draft that you feel when you are in front of the door that is closed. All of these are indicators to locate an expert near me who offers weatherstripping repairs.

Taskers can seal your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are constructed from open or closed-cell foam and come in a range of widths, thicknesses, and qualities to fit all kinds of cracks. They are easy to install and are easily cut with scissors. Felt strips are inexpensive and last for a long time. They can be cut in length using scissors and glued to the frame of the door or the hinge side of a sliding or double-hung window with glue, staples, or tacks. Metal V strips or vinyl are a bit more difficult to set up, but can be attached to the window repair jamb.

In certain situations it might be more beneficial to replace your window rather than repair it.

Fogging of the glass is a typical problem with double-paned window. The airtight seal between the two panes is not working properly. Depending on the cause of the leak, it could be possible to fix the issue by resealing the window. If the window has been exposed for a long time to the elements,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.
